Jimi Hendrix
Perhaps one of the most famous members of the 27 Club, Jimi Hendrix died on September 18, 1970, from asphyxia due to inhaling vomit after a night of partying. Known for revolutionizing rock music with his groundbreaking guitar playing, Hendrix’s death was a huge loss to the music world.

Janis Joplin
On October 4, 1970, just weeks after Hendrix’s death, Janis Joplin, the iconic blues singer, died of a heroin overdose. Joplin was known for her raw, emotional voice and her undeniable influence on rock and roll. Her untimely death solidified her place in the 27 Club.

Jim Morrison
The legendary lead singer of The Doors, Jim Morrison, died on July 3, 1971, in Paris under mysterious circumstances. Though the official cause was listed as heart failure, rumors surrounding his death persist, leaving fans to wonder if the pressures of fame played a role. Morrison was known for his poetic lyrics and mesmerizing stage presence.

Can you grow between 16 and 18?

Most girls stop growing taller by age 14 or 15. However, after their early teenage growth spurt, boys continue gaining height at a gradual pace until around 18. Note that some kids will stop growing earlier and others may keep growing a year or two more.
